Authorship Attribution
UTC 15:25:13 on April 25, 2014 converts to 11:25 AM EDT (Trump Tower, Manhattan; Eastern Daylight Time = UTC−4, operative in late April). This falls within business hours, which statistically correlates with aide authorship. However, several features argue for authentic Trump composition:
- Format signature: Quote-tweeting a fan's compliment verbatim and responding with a brief "Thank you." is a well-documented, high-frequency pattern in Trump's 2013–2015 Twitter archive. Aides tend toward structured announcements; this format is organic and impulsive.
- Spacing artifacts: Double space after "Love" suggests unedited, direct-entry composition rather than polished aide drafting.
- HTML entity artifact (
&): Reflects raw Twitter rendering of the quoted tweet; an aide curating the post would likely have cleaned this. - Behavioral context: The surrounding posts on the same day — retweeted #TrumpForPrez calls, a trade complaint, self-quotes — show a high-volume, reactive posting cadence consistent with direct personal engagement.
Assessment: Leaning authentic with medium confidence. Daytime timing introduces uncertainty, but stylometric and behavioral evidence favors Trump himself.
